Volleyball Splits Pair of Matches to Finish the College of Charleston Invitational
8/28/2021 9:08:00 PM | Volleyball
The Eagles completed the comeback against Montana, but fell to Indiana State
CHARLESTON, S.C. (EMUEagles.com) – The Eastern Michigan University volleyball team played two matches Saturday, Aug. 28, to close the College of Charleston Invitational in Charleston, S.C., falling 3-1 (15-25, 22-25, 25-23, 14-25) to Indiana State to start the day and defeating Montana, 3-2 (23-25, 25-27, 25-21, 25-15, 15-12), to finish the weekend.
Eastern 1, Indiana State 3
EMU fell 15-25, 22-25, 25-23, and 14-25 to Indiana State in the day's first action. Though Eastern won the third set and led in moments through the match, it ultimately did not have the juice to take the sets.
Freshman Annie Lockett (Mason, Ohio-Mason) and redshirt freshman Krista Blakely (Detroit, Mich.-University High School Academy) led the Green and White with 12 kills each. Lockett and Blakely were aided by sophomore Samantha Basham (Granville, Ohio-Newark Catholic) and redshirt sophomore Raeven Chase (Toronto, Ontario, Canada-Michael Power St. Joseph Catholic), who added eight and six kills, respectively.
Quarterbacking the offense was sophomore Jayden Otto (Crystal Lake, Ill.-Prairie Ridge) with 39 assists. The setter also tallied seven digs and two kills.
Defensively, the Eagles were led by sophomore Kamryn Stilwell (Parma, Ohio-Padua Francisan), who posted 17 digs, while Basham added 11. Chase was a force again at the net with a team-high six blocks.
Eastern 3, Montana 2
Eastern Michigan finished the day with a comeback, defeating Montana 3-2 (23-25, 25-27, 25-21, 25-23, 15-12), after being down two sets. Down 2-1, the Eagles never looked back in sets four and five. Eastern Michigan posted a 12-point lead, 22-10, before winning the set 25-15.
Lockett again dominated the outside with a career-high 17 kills, while Blakely and Chase posted double figure kills with 14 and 12, respectively. Additionally, freshman Madeline Timmerman (Crystal Lake, Ill.-Central) tallied seven kills as well as five blocks.
Setting up the EMU offense was Otto again as she led with 48 assists. The sophomore posted a double-double by adding 11 digs.
Four Eagles recorded 10-plus digs in Stilwell (17), freshman Bella Hommes (Grand Rapids, Mich.-Forest Hills Central) (12), Otto (11), and junior Mackenzie Garis (Crystal Lake, Ill.-Prairie Ridge) (10). Blakely led the Eagles with six blocks.
